New Juaben South Assembly Courts Hospitality Industry for Development Partnership

The New Juaben South Municipal Assembly has opened a new chapter of collaboration with the hospitality sector, bringing together hotel owners, hostel operators, and guest house managers for high-level discussions aimed at revitalizing the municipality's economic landscape.

 The engagement, led by Municipal Chief Executive Hon. Ransford Owusu Boakye, signaled a shift from traditional regulatory oversight toward a more collaborative approach between local government and industry stakeholders.

"We Need Everyone On Board"

Addressing operators at the meeting, MCE Owusu Boakye struck a conciliatory tone, urging industry players to view the Assembly as a development partner rather than merely a regulatory body.

"The Assembly will need everybody on board in order to rebrand Koforidua and its environs for economic and tourism purposes," he stated.

The hospitality sector remains a cornerstone of the municipality's economy, providing critical accommodation services for visitors, creating employment for residents, generating income for local businesses, and enhancing the area's appeal as a destination.

Balancing Responsibilities and Concerns

While emphasizing partnership, the MCE did not shy away from reminding operators of their civic obligations. He called on them to promptly settle taxes, fees, and other legitimate revenues due to the Assembly as their contribution to municipal development.

Open Forum Addresses Key Challenges

The engagement provided a platform for stakeholders to voice pressing concerns affecting their operations. Sanitation issues and deteriorating road networks emerged as primary challenges hampering business growth in the area.

Management responded with assurances of action on both fronts, describing the dialogue as "a step towards building a stronger partnership between local government and the hospitality sector."
